In production, we standardize Mushroom Polypeptide across ranges by protein content, moisture percentage, and fractional peptide length distribution. Years of batch-to-batch analysis have shown that a peptide size within the 500-2000 Dalton range translates into good penetration properties and dispersibility for industrial, cosmetic, or health-focused products. Too large, and it won’t dissolve well; too short, and the functional groups do not perform their bioactive roles. Each lot sheet reflects these details, drawn directly from actual instrumental results, not theoretical numbers. We’ve pushed our drying process to maintain protein content in excess of 70% by weight and have locked in a routine moisture level below 5%, avoiding microbial risk without heavy chemical preservatives.
Our Mushroom Polypeptide takes shape as a fine, off-white to pale beige powder—no strange odors and dissolves easily in aqueous bases. Technicians adjusting pH for emulsification or encapsulation will find our peptide responds predictably across a typical 4.5 to 8.5 pH spectrum with no sticky residue or unwanted gelation that complicates large-scale blending. Peptides from a range of natural sources crowd the market—plant, dairy, marine, even synthetics. Mushroom Polypeptide drew our attention because it stands apart on several key points. Fungal peptides develop antibiotic defensive properties as a survival trait in their parent organisms. This gives our product distinct bioactive performances compared to casein-based hydrolysates or simple soy proteins, which rarely demonstrate antimicrobial or immunomodulatory functions. We’ve run in-house assays and supported university collaborations that show clear antioxidant activity and the ability to block certain pathogenic bacteria, not just in cell models but in food matrices as well.

Fielding technical questions from customers is part of our daily work. Formulators ask about optimal inclusion rates, storage stability, even sensory aspects on the industrial line. Years of feedback guides our focus. Mushroom Polypeptide, thanks to its steady dispersibility and neutral flavor, has staked out strong positions in ready-to-mix drink blends and nutrition bars. The functional food sector demands ingredients that remain undetectable in finished product, offering benefits without overshadowing other flavors or creating texture issues.
Our clients in the supplement field cite batch stability for encapsulated forms and the way our peptides avoid bitter off-notes often associated with some hydrolyzed products. This comes from careful thermal and enzymatic processing, curated specifically to trim away bitter fragments during hydrolysis. In topical applications—creams, masks, lotions—the even particle size and low ash content have been praised for promoting smoother emulsification and improving active retention rates. No sticky residues left on skin, which avoids consumer complaints and product returns.
For biotechnical and agricultural customers, Mushroom Polypeptide has played a part in biostimulant development. Field trials show benefits in enhancing nutrient uptake and plant resilience under drought or temperature swings.
